The SN74AUP3G17DQER is a triple Schmitt-trigger buffer from Texas Instruments, designed for low-power and low-voltage applications. It operates over a wide supply voltage range of 0.8V to 3.6V, making it ideal for battery-powered and portable devices. The device features three independent buffers with Schmitt-trigger inputs, providing hysteresis for noise immunity and slow input signal conditioning. Housed in a compact 8-X2SON (1.4mm x 1.0mm) package, it is suitable for space-constrained designs.
| Parameter | Value |
|---|---|
| Supply Voltage (Vcc) | 0.8V to 3.6V |
| Input Voltage Range | 0V to 3.6V |
| Output Drive Current | ±4 mA at 3.0V |
| Propagation Delay (tpd) | 4.3 ns typical at 3.3V |
| Quiescent Current (Icc) | 0.9 µA max |
| Operating Temperature | -40°C to +85°C |
| Package | 8-X2SON (1.4mm x 1.0mm) |
| Logic Family | AUP (Advanced Ultra-Low Power) |
